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59647927419 598908057 11 74 581668632
85773701450 8274 1359883190
85773701450 8274 1359883190
61 4263 0740
All about undefined
Interested in learning more?
85773701450 8274 1359883190
61 4263 0740
See more
86 40929 55
9867215 46945167 64957
See more
2662555 28197 3509494
6547995 39 9588877 48479235 389208
See more